Everyday is a Holy Day: Paul Lyngdoh on STIEH opposing Cherry Blossom fest on Sunday

Shillong, Oct 18: Meghalaya Tourism Minister Paul Lyngdoh said on Wednesday that every day is a “Holy Day” but not just on a particular day.

This statement comes a day after Saindur Tipkur Tipkha Ehrngiew Hynniewtrep (STIEH) issued a memorandum to Tourism Minister Paul Lyngdoh objecting to the decision to conclude the Cherry Blossom Festival on Sunday.

While talking to reporters, Lyngdoh said, “everyday is holy and precious, and it is not that people become holy and faithful for a particular week or a day, and become unholy for the rest of the week.”

It must be noted that the Saindur Tipkur Tipkha Ehrngiew Hynniewtrep (STIEH) has opposed concluding the Shillong Cherry Blossom Festival on a Sunday. The festival is scheduled to happen on 17 (Friday),18 (Saturday) and 19 (Sunday) in Bhoirymbong.

Sunday’s for Christians are typically considered a day of worship.
